Should WT be upgraded to Mediawiki 1.3 now that a stable version is released?
- The new Monobook design is nice;
- We could use the Categories;
- The Templates ({{template}}) still do not work.
BTW, this page is over 46 KB. Yann 09:05, 24 Aug 2004 (EDT)
- I'll see what I can do to fix the templates problem on French Wikitravel. I personally hate the Monobook design, but it'd be good to have an option. And the PHPTal stuff would be good for making a Wikitravel skin.
- I see no reason to use categories; in fact, I think they're a really crappy hack. We need much better metadata input than that; I'm working on adding Turtle support so we can add richer metadata. Anyways, I'll probably disable categories until we've got a good plan for them.
- 1.3 does have the option to add a real name to your user account, and to get attribution on the pages ("This page created by X, Y, and Z"). I'll probably enable those, since it makes it a lot easier for redistributors to comply with our copyleft.
- Anyways, I'll probably do a 1.3 upgrade in about 2 weeks (I'll be away next week). I'd like to get the three new language versions going at about the same time, so I only have to do 6 installs instead of 9. I'll post well ahead of time when I'm ready to go. --Evan 15:31, 24 Aug 2004 (EDT)
- Personally, I'd like categories because they'd make it so much easier to navigate around geographical areas, instead of relying on region pages being up to date (which they won't be). Jpatokal 07:09, 30 Aug 2004 (EDT)
